Transaction e4c3403e65dac77a77ffc333e0b94be08572b55ec13bcfa391ebdba56c3dc634
1 Input
2 Outputs
- e4c3403e65dac77a77ffc333e0b94be08572b55ec13bcfa391ebdba56c3dc634:0
- e4c3403e65dac77a77ffc333e0b94be08572b55ec13bcfa391ebdba56c3dc634:1
value 9835780
address 1JUFFWGZPpA438rZYLFcrXJb2Xi8MmyawN
value 10500000
address 1PFvR9Y7SSbnEdXGQQH6R21CUrsr87urcs